European Stocks Rise in Early Trading, UK Up 0.98%
[Asia Economy Reporter Changhwan Lee] European stock markets are showing early gains.

As of 5:35 PM on the 16th (Korea time), the UK FTSE 100 index stood at 6,577.67, up 0.98% from the previous trading day; the German DAX index was at 13,536.45, up 1.33%; and the French CAC index recorded 5,582.98, up 0.97%.
